TBR writes “We all know that security shouldn’t be an afterthought when it comes to system design and development, but unless you know how a hacker attempts to crack a system how can you code for it?

The Anti-Hacker Toolkit isn’t really designed for developers as such. It’s a book that’s aimed at those who need to defend rather than offend, which in practice means system admins, security personnel, web developers and so on. It takes the view that the best way of defending against attacks is to understand how attacks take place – what tools and techniques are likely to be used to launch attacks? And just what are the different types of attacks?”
